软件仓库,通常指(zhǐ )的是存储(chǔ )、管理和分发软件包的系统(tǒng )或位置,在软件开发和部署的过程中,软件仓(cāng )库(🈶)扮演着至关重要的(😖)角(jiǎo )色,它们不(bú )仅为开(🙃)发者提供了一个集中的地(dì )方来存放他们的代码和软件包,而且还使得(dé )其他开发者能够轻松地查找、下载和使用这些资源。
软件仓库的种类(lè(🌎)i )
软件仓库根据其功(🔇)能和访问方式可以分为几种类型,最常(🎮)见的(🎦)包括本地仓库(kù )和远程仓库,本地(dì )仓库通常位于(yú )开发者的个人计(jì )算机或局域网内,便于(yú )开发者对(🎮)代码进行快速修改和测试,而(🥤)(ér )远程(🚃)仓库则位于互联网(🚑)(wǎng )上,允许开发者与全世界的(de )其他开发者(zhě )共享和协作代码。
使用软件仓库的好处(chù )
使(shǐ )用(yòng )软件仓库带来的好处是多方面的,它极大地(dì )方便了(le )代码的版本控(🌜)制(zhì ),使得多(🔏)人协(🔖)作(zuò )成为可能,软件(jiàn )仓库通过提供(gòng )统一的代(dài )码存(cún )储和分发机(👰)制,确保了软(ruǎn )件(jiàn )包的一(yī )致性和(hé )可(🦐)靠性,许多现(🎟)代的(🤤)软件仓(🛏)库还提供(🚉)了丰富的工具和接口(🥗),如自动化构建和测试工(gōng )具,进一步提(🥚)高了开发效率。
软件仓(📸)库的挑战
尽管软件(jià(🦑)n )仓库带来了许多便利,但在实际应用中也面临一些挑战,对(duì )于大型(xíng )项目而言,如何有效地管理大量的代码和用户权限是一个问(wèn )题,保证软件仓库的(🥣)(de )安全性,防止未授权访问和数据(😕)泄露(lù )也是一个重要的考(💶)量点(diǎn )。
未来(🏫)趋势
随着云计算和(hé )人工智(zhì )能技术的(⏭)(de )发展,预(🔲)(yù )计软件仓库将变得更加智能化和自动化,通过机器学习算法(fǎ )自动检测代(🐟)码中的错误和安(🈚)全漏洞,以及优化代码(mǎ )存储和检索过程,随(🎤)着开源(yuán )文化的进(jìn )一步普及,软件仓(🔫)库可能会更加(jiā )注重促(🧤)(cù )进全球范(🚇)(fàn )围内的协作和共享。
软件仓(💉)(cāng )库作为软件开发不可或缺的一部(🚾)分,不仅简化了开发(fā )流(liú )程,还促进了知(zhī )识(💆)的共享和(hé )创新的发(🗻)展,面对未来(lái ),软(ruǎn )件仓库将继续演化,以满足日益增长的技术需求和挑(tiāo )战。
视频本站于2024-10-24 12:10:33收藏于/影片特辑。观看内地vip票房,反派角色合作好看特效故事中心展开制作。特别提醒如果您对影片有自己的看法请留言弹幕评论。